Liters to ci conversion
just wonderin, what's the going rate between Liters and Cubic Inches?
Was wondering how many liters a 468 block is, for instance. Thanks

Re: Liters to ci conversion
One litre is right about 61 c.i. in volume......
468??...coming in right about 7.65 litres. it's a big-un. |

Re: Liters to ci conversion
1 inch = 2.54 cm
1 cubic inch = 2.54^3 cm^3 = 16.387064 cm^3 1 litre = 1000 cm^3 = 61.02374409 c.i. |
